QA-инженер — это специалист в мире разработки программного обеспечения, который заботится о качестве на каждом этапе создания продукта. Это не просто тестировщик, а аналитик и стратег, который работает рука об руку с программистами и менеджером проектов. Основная задача High Quality Assurance инженера — предотвратить ошибки еще до начала разработки, снизить потери при запуске продукта на рынок. Этот специалист участвует в планировании, разработке тестовых сценариев, анализе полученных данных и внедрении процессов обеспечения качества. QA engineer, как и тестировщики, делятся на мануальных и автоматизаторов.
- В зависимости от вида тестируемого ПО инженер должен знать на базовом уровне языки программирования, на которых оно создано.
- Обладая названными компетенциями, QA-инженеры обеспечивают высокое качество продуктов и успешный выход на рынок.
- Благодаря работе такого специалиста можно гарантировать высокое качество продукта и соблюдение всех стандартов.
- QA-инженер знает программный код ПО и использует его для поиска ошибок.
- В этой статье мы рассмотрим основные типы инструментов, которые используют тестировщики, их функции и преимущества.
1% самых высокооплачиваемых QA-специалистов получают от $6500. Важно иметь аналитические способности, быть внимательным к деталям и постоянно развиваться. Опыта и знаний можно набраться через курсы, практика и самообразование.
Например, если планируется разработка мобильного приложения, целесообразно знать Appium, XCUITest, Android Debug Bridge что такое qa engineer (adb), Minimal ADB. Начать работать QA можно мануальным тестировщиком, а позже перейти в автоматизированное. Для этого нужно знать английский, разбираться в протоколах и знать, что самое главное в тестировании. Эта работа помогает понять, как делают ПО, но с другой стороны психологически может быть сложно все время говорить людям, где они сделали ошибку. Артем Бородатюк советует изучить карту знаний, которую разработали в Netpeak Group.
Альтернативой учебе в ui ux дизайн вузе является курсы, обучающая программа которых направлена именно на изучение профессии. Кроме того, длительность учебы на курсах меньше, чем в институте. Заметим, что формальные требования могут различаться в зависимости от конкретного работодателя и страны, а также сферы работы. Как правило, компании предпочитают кандидатов с техническим или информационным образованием.
Что Нужно Для Того, Чтобы Освоить Эту Профессию?
Большим плюсом будут минимальные знания SQL и соответствующих инструментов для работы с базами данных (SQL Server Management Studio/DBeaver/Navicat). Обладает достаточным набором навыков для того, чтобы быть автономной единицей в рамках большинства задач, а также релевантным опытом, который поможет предупредить некоторые ошибки на этапе планирования. Также я встречал мнение, что миддл может менторить джунов, но я бы не сказал, что это будет полноценный менторинг — скорее инструкции для конкретных проектов. Эти инструменты помогают экономить время, выполняя рутинные задачи быстрее и с меньшей вероятностью ошибок.
Это отличный способ освоить перспективную профессию с нуля, не выходя из дома. Ключевые преимущества включают гибкость обучения, доступ к актуальным инструментам и технологиям, а также возможность начать зарабатывать уже в процессе обучения. QA Engineer – профессия, связанная с поиском, устранением багов, а также с планированием тестирования, контролем за рабочим процессом как разработчиков, так и того, чем занимается тестировщик. Эта должность объединяет в себе роли специалиста по контролю качества, тестировщика и даже, в некоторых случаях, тимлида. Например, в одном из проектов по разработке мобильного приложения для финансовых услуг, QA-инженер заметил аномалии в работе системы при проведении транзакций.
В инфографике представлен диапазон зарплат на основе данных hh.ru, career https://deveducation.com/.habr.com. У тестировщиков есть несколько ключевых документов, которые стоит вести вне зависимости от специфики вашего продукта. Часто работодатели желают, чтобы у соискателя был опыт работы в области QA или стаж работы на смежных должностях.
Инструменты, Onerous И Soft Abilities, Без Которых Не Стать Qa
Индустрия информационных технологий стремительно развивается, и профессия тестировщика программного обеспечения становится все более востребованной. Онлайн-курсы предоставляют уникальную возможность освоить эту профессию с нуля или повысить квалификацию в удобном формате. В этой статье мы разберем, кому подойдут курсы тестировщика и какие преимущества они предлагают. Для тех, кто рассматривает карьеру в качестве специальности QA-инженера, важно знать минимальные требования, которые обычно предъявляются к начинающим специалистам. Эти требования помогут определить, какие навыки и знания необходимо развивать для успешного входа в профессию. Также можно ориентироваться на эту информацию при выборе курсов QA специалиста.
В нашей статье мы узнали, чем же занимается QA-инженер, в чем его особенность, где лучше освоить эту профессию и с какими трудностями может столкнуться начинающий специалист. QA-инженер участвует во всех этапах разработки ПО, тестирует его функциональность, производительность и удобство. В отличие от обычного тестировщика, он не только выявляет баги, но и разрабатывает процессы, которые помогают их минимизировать. Ещё QA-специалисты переходят в сферу разработки программного обеспечения или осваивают смежные отрасли и становятся продакт-менеджерами, бизнес-аналитиками, UX/UI-дизайнерами.
Курсы тестировщика программного обеспечения становятся все более популярными среди тех, кто хочет начать карьеру в IT. Этот путь подходит как для новичков, так и для тех, кто уже имеет технический опыт, но хочет сменить сферу деятельности. В этой статье мы расскажем, как проходит обучение на таких курсах, какие навыки вы получите и чего ожидать от процесса обучения.
В сегодняшней статье мы попробуем разобраться в тонкостях, особенностях и значении данной специальности. И главный совет — чередуйте теорию и практику, пробуя делать руками всё то, что прочитали в книге или узнали на курсах. — Для того чтобы стать успешным QA-инженером, советую правильно подойти к процессу обучения. Больше всего их в Москве, на втором месте — Санкт-Петербург, а затем идёт Татарстан и Новосибирская область. Нужны специалисты разного уровня — от джуниоров до тимлидов. QA-инженер не имеет полного доступа к программному коду или вынужден оценивать его работоспособность со стороны интерфейса.